Did he go to school yesterday?
No, he didn't go to school yesterday. He went to the beach.
What does he do every day?
He brushes his teeth every day.
Is she going to watch a movie later today?
No, she isn't going to watch a movie. She is going to eat ice cream.
Will he read a book tomorrow?
No, he will not read a book tomorrow. He will run on the beach.
Is she playing volleyball right now?
No, she is not playing volleyball right now. She is playing with her dog.
Did he go swimming yesterday?
No, he didn't go swimming yesterday. He went skateboarding.
What was he doing last night?
He was playing the piano last night.
What is he going to do this afternoon?
He is going to go ice skating this afternoon.
Did he go fishing yesterday?
No, he didn't go fishing yesterday. He played the violin.
Is he running right now?
No, he isn't running. He is dancing.
Was he flying a kite at the beach yesterday?
Yes, he was flying a kite at the beach yesterday.
What is it doing right now?
It's using a computer right now.
What were they doing yesterday?
They were playing a board game yesterday.
What does she do every day?
She reads a book every day?
Does he like his homework?
No, he doesn't like his homework.
What is he doing?
He's talking on the phone.
Is he going to have a party?
No, he isn't going to have a party. He is going to sleep.
Does she know how to drive?
Yes, she knows how to drive.
